OpenAI names next model Astra, publishes 10 open-math proofs

OpenAI said on August 1 that its next major model family, now named Astra, produced machine-checkable Lean 4 proofs for ten previously open problems in mathematics and theoretical computer science, each unsolved for at least a decade, alongside a 249-page technical manuscript. The headline result is the first explicit construction of a non-sofic group, a central open question in group theory, and OpenAI said the compute cost across all ten solutions was roughly $2,000 at Sol API rates; Fields medalist Timothy Gowers called it a milestone for AI-assisted mathematics. Astra itself remains unreleased.
